![240](https://upload.jianshu.io/users/upload_avatars/17255141/9c0b1fe6-c534-44d3-afe4-b119a5f0b031.jpg?imageMogr2/auto-orient/strip|imageView2/1/w/240/h/240)
1 前言 實(shí)現(xiàn)一個(gè)排版榜弦牡,我們通常想到的就是mysql的order by 簡(jiǎn)單粗暴就擼出來了。但是這樣真的優(yōu)雅嗎漂羊? 數(shù)據(jù)庫(kù)是系統(tǒng)的瓶頸驾锰,這是眾所周知的。如果給你一張百萬的表走越,...
背景: 最近由于公司要做統(tǒng)一的數(shù)據(jù)變更記錄买喧,以前是基于Aop來做的捻悯,這樣效率很低,而且在做批量處理(insert,update,delete)操作時(shí)基本不可用淤毛。所以我打算使用...
MySQL 前綴索引 當(dāng)要索引的列字符很多時(shí) 索引則會(huì)很大且變慢( 可以只索引列開始的部分字符串 節(jié)約索引空間 從而提高索引效率 ) 原則: 降低重復(fù)的索引值 例如現(xiàn)在有一個(gè)...
一. Netty做了什么艺挪? 1.Netty實(shí)現(xiàn)了對(duì)Java NIO的封裝不翩,提供了更方便使用的接口; 2.Netty利用責(zé)任鏈模式實(shí)現(xiàn)了ChannelPipeline這一概念,...
提醒:本篇適合有一定netty基礎(chǔ)的讀者閱讀 心跳機(jī)制 何為心跳 所謂心跳, 即在 TCP 長(zhǎng)連接中, 客戶端和服務(wù)器之間定期發(fā)送的一種特殊的數(shù)據(jù)包, 通知對(duì)方自己還在線, ...